Fabulous small group tour! Our guide was extremely courteous and knowledgeable about the flora and fauna. Breakfast with the animals at Featherdale Wildlife Park was a treat. We were the only group there at that early hour, and were able to enjoy the animals all to ourselves. Great buffet lunch at the historic Imperial Hotel, which is said to be haunted by three ghosts. The Blue Mountains were spectacular, and our stop to spend time with the "roos" at a remote location in the evening was a special treat. Our arrival into Sydney just after dusk via ferry capped the trip. The city lights were magnificent. It was a very full day but certainly worth it.
